Regular dance practice offers numerous health and wellness benefits. Dance exercises help improve physical fitness and heart health, boost self-esteem and confidence, reduce stress, and enhance social skills. In this article, we'll take a closer look at the advantages of making dance a regular habit.
Physical Fitness and Heart Health
Dance is a great way to improve your physical fitness, strengthen muscles, and enhance coordination and flexibility. Studies show that dancing can help reduce the risk of heart disease and stroke, as exercise increases the strength and efficiency of your heart.
Mood Boost and Stress Reduction
Dance classes can positively impact mental health by helping to lower stress and anxiety levels. Participating in group dance sessions improves mood, self-esteem, and confidence.
Improved Social Skills
Dance is an excellent way to develop social skills and build confidence when interacting with others. Dance classes provide opportunities to connect with people, work as a team, and enhance communication abilities.
Fostering Creativity
Dance is a form of creative expression that helps nurture the arts. During dance classes, you develop your ear and sensitivity to music, improve your sense of rhythm, and learn to express yourself through movement.
Enhanced Memory and Coordination
Dance exercises improve memory and coordination, which are essential for executing various moves. By dancing, you train your brain to command your body, positively impacting overall brain function.
In conclusion, regular dance practice offers a wide range of benefits that positively affect physical health, mental well-being, and social experience. Regardless of age, there are many dance styles and genres to explore, ensuring everyone can find something they enjoy.
